Cover Story: Hard alloy end mills are commonly used in dentistry to mill zirconia prostheses. Nano-diamond (ND) coating improves wear resistance, enhancing the performance and durability of milling tools. This study aims to assess the effects of ND-coated milling bits on the glossiness and roughness of unsintered and sintered zirconia surfaces at different spindle speeds when milling zirconia green blanks. Sintered zirconia blocks had higher glossiness than unsintered blocks. The ND-coated milling bit resulted in higher glossiness for sintered zirconia at all speeds, whereas the uncoated milling bit can only achieve the same glossiness at 1500 rpm. Sintering significantly reduces roughness in zirconia. Overall, the ND-coated milling bit can achieve higher glossiness on sintered zirconia at various speeds, while the uncoated bit only achieves the same glossiness at a specific speed. View this paper
